What Is the Square Structure on Mars?

The image at the center of the controversy was originally captured by NASA’s Mars Global Surveyor mission in 2001.
The photograph shows part of a cratered region on Mars where a feature appears to form an almost square outline. When the image was cropped and shared online, the geometric shape became the primary focus. Many viewers saw what looked like a gigantic foundation, wall system, or artificial enclosure.
The timing of the image’s resurgence played a major role in its popularity.
Social media platforms amplified the discussion, and high-profile figures helped draw attention to the photograph. Soon, millions of people were examining the image and debating whether Mars might contain evidence of an ancient civilization.
The phenomenon closely mirrored previous viral Mars mysteries, including the famous “Face on Mars” and the so-called Martian doorway that captivated internet users in recent years.
Why the Image Looked So Artificial
The reaction was understandable.
Human beings are exceptionally good at recognizing patterns.
Throughout evolution, our ancestors benefited from quickly identifying faces, shelters, animals, and other meaningful shapes in their environment.
Sometimes that skill becomes so powerful that the brain identifies familiar structures where none actually exist.
Psychologists call this phenomenon pareidolia.
It explains why people see faces in clouds, animals in rock formations, and familiar objects in random visual patterns.
The square formation on Mars triggered exactly this response.
The shape appeared to possess features commonly associated with human construction:
- Straight lines
- Sharp corners
- Geometric proportions
- Apparent symmetry
To many observers, those characteristics seemed difficult to explain through natural processes alone.
But nature has a long history of creating structures that look surprisingly engineered.

Mars Has a Long History of Strange Discoveries

The square structure is only the latest entry in a long catalog of mysterious-looking Martian features.
Over the years, observers have claimed to find:
- Faces
- Pyramids
- Skulls
- Statues
- Doorways
- Towers
- Animal-like shapes
The most famous example remains the Face on Mars.
When NASA’s Viking spacecraft photographed the Cydonia region in 1976, a mesa appeared to resemble a giant human face staring skyward.
The image sparked decades of speculation.
Books were written.
Documentaries were produced.
Theories flourished.
Eventually, higher-resolution images revealed the feature to be an ordinary landform whose face-like appearance resulted from lighting and viewing angles.
The mystery largely disappeared.
But the lesson remained.
Mars has a remarkable ability to generate illusions.
What Scientists Found When They Looked Closer

The most important development in the square-structure story came years after the original image was captured.
NASA’s Mars Reconnaissance Orbiter later photographed the same region using much more advanced imaging technology.
The higher-resolution images told a different story.
What appeared to be a perfect square in the original photograph was revealed to be a far more irregular geological formation. Features that looked like connected walls and corners from a distance appeared much less organized when viewed in greater detail.
NASA researchers noted that one of the apparent corners was actually part of a cliff-like feature unrelated to the rest of the shape. The illusion of a square emerged largely because of perspective, shadows, image resolution, and the way the human brain interprets incomplete visual information.
The more detailed observations significantly weakened arguments that the structure represented an artificial construction.
Why Nature Creates Geometric Shapes
One reason these stories persist is that many people assume geometry is exclusively a product of intelligence.
In reality, nature produces geometric forms all the time.
On Earth, natural processes create:
- Hexagonal basalt columns
- Crystal lattices
- Polygonal rock formations
- Rectangular fractures
- Symmetrical cave structures
The famous Giant’s Causeway in Northern Ireland contains thousands of naturally occurring hexagonal columns.
Certain deserts display nearly perfect polygonal patterns.
Crystals can produce astonishing geometric precision.
Mars experiences many of the same physical principles.
Rock fractures, erosion, volcanic activity, mineral deposition, and ancient groundwater movement can all generate surprisingly structured formations.
Recent NASA investigations of Martian “boxwork” formations demonstrate how groundwater flowing through fractures can leave behind mineral patterns that later become exposed through erosion, producing intricate geometric networks across the landscape.
The existence of geometric shapes alone is not evidence of intelligent design.

Could Mars Have Hosted Ancient Life?
While the square structure itself is unlikely to be an alien ruin, Mars remains one of the most compelling locations in the Solar System for searching for evidence of past life.
Scientists have accumulated substantial evidence that ancient Mars was very different from the cold desert we see today.
Billions of years ago, the planet likely possessed:
- Rivers
- Lakes
- Groundwater systems
- A thicker atmosphere
NASA’s Curiosity rover has spent years investigating regions where water once flowed, while studies of boxwork formations suggest groundwater remained active in some locations later than previously expected. These discoveries help scientists understand whether ancient Mars may once have supported microbial life.
The search continues.
But researchers are looking for signs of ancient microorganisms, not giant square buildings.
